An albatross is a large bird that can fly 400 kilometers in 8 hours at a constant speed. Using d for distance in kilometers and t for number of hours, an equation that represents this situation is d=50t. What are two constants of proportionality for the relationship between distance in kilometers and number of hours? 50 1/50

Answer: Two constants of proportionality for this situation are 50 and 1/50. The relationship between these two values are that they are both reciprocals.

Answer:

50

Explanation:

Speed is represented according to the equation;

Speed = Distance/Time

Given;

Distance d = 400km

Time t = 8 hours

From the formula

s = d/t

s = 400/8

s = 50

Substitute s = 50 back into the formula;

s = d/t

50 = d/t

d = 50t

This expression means that the speed is directly proportional to t where 50 is the constant of proportionality;

Hence the constant of proportionality for the relationship between distance in kilometers and number of hours is 50
